From 04eaa758822413a1f741200fda38ad725c646285 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: 0xrsydn Date: Mon, 6 Apr 2026 19:15:19 +0700 Subject: [PATCH] fix: handle missing scrip column in April 2026 KSEI PDF The April 2026 IDX ownership PDF omits the zero-valued scrip column for some holders, causing the parser to leave holdings_scripless/scrip as empty strings. This broke normalize_ksei_row which called parse_id_number on empty input. Two-layer fix: - Parser: pop_numeric_tail handles 2-column (missing scrip) rows by defaulting scrip to "0" - Normalizer: parse_id_number_or_zero backstop treats empty component share fields as 0 while still requiring total_shares Also includes AGENTS.md refresh, formatting cleanup (rustfmt), and version bump to 0.2.2.
